From: Jaroslav Kysela Date: Wed, 5 Apr 2017 15:33:15 +0000 (+0200) Subject: idnode: call idnode_changedfn() from idnode_changed(), fixes #4306 X-Git-Tag: v4.2.1~29 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=a85b39d692a4469dde3f7e4f5f04f27986cac7dc;p=thirdparty%2Ftvheadend.git idnode: call idnode_changedfn() from idnode_changed(), fixes #4306 --- diff --git a/src/idnode.c b/src/idnode.c index 80b729452..3d8fad09c 100644 --- a/src/idnode.c +++ b/src/idnode.c @@ -1202,6 +1202,7 @@ void idnode_changed( idnode_t *self ) { idnode_notify_changed(self); + idnode_changedfn(self); idnode_save_queue(self); } diff --git a/src/input/mpegts/satip/satip_satconf.c b/src/input/mpegts/satip/satip_satconf.c index 016d6cbf1..350bd65df 100644 --- a/src/input/mpegts/satip/satip_satconf.c +++ b/src/input/mpegts/satip/satip_satconf.c @@ -316,8 +316,8 @@ static void satip_satconf_class_changed ( idnode_t *in ) { satip_satconf_t *sfc = (satip_satconf_t*)in; - satip_device_changed(sfc->sfc_lfe->sf_device); satip_satconf_sanity_check(sfc->sfc_lfe); + satip_device_changed(sfc->sfc_lfe->sf_device); } CLASS_DOC(satip_satconf)